NATO countries will provide $7 million to support women in the Ukrainian Armed Forces. The assistance will include more than 10,000 uniforms, shoes and other necessary equipment.

According to the Ministry of Defence, the assistance was announced by US Secretary of State Antony Blinken at a reception after the NATO Women, Peace and Security roundtable held as part of the Alliance Summit in Washington. 

"Too often, Ukrainian servicewomen do not have the necessary equipment to meet their unique needs in full. Today, we are taking a step to remedy this by announcing that NATO Allies will provide more than $7 million in equipment for women in the Ukrainian Armed Forces. We applaud every Ally who has come forward to help with this initiative," Blinken said.

The Ministry clarified that negotiations with NATO on the possibility of additional funding for the production of women's military uniforms and bulletproof vests for the Armed Forces of Ukraine have been ongoing since 2023 and made significant progress in March 2024, when Deputy Minister of Defence of Ukraine Nataliya Kalmykova met with the NATO Secretary General's Special Representative for Women, Peace and Security, Irene Phelin, and Head of the NATO Representation to Ukraine, Karen McTeer.

The parties agreed to exchange experience, consultations and mutual assistance in implementing the principles of gender equality in the Security and Defence Forces of Ukraine. They also agreed to provide significant financial assistance to help provide women servicewomen with the necessary ammunition and equipment.
